Oracle Cloud 26B: Smarter WMS, Mobile, Integration, and Logistics

The Oracle Cloud 26B release is not just another quarterly update it reflects a clear evolution in how warehouse operations, integrations, and decision-making are being reimagined.

From my perspective working across Oracle Cloud WMS and Fusion integrations, what stands out is how closely these enhancements align with real-world operational challenges that teams face every day.
Let’s break this down.

First, the WMS capability enhancements are quietly powerful. Many organizations struggle with balancing standardization and flexibility in warehouse processes. The new updates move closer to that sweet spot offering improved configurability while maintaining control. This is particularly relevant in high-volume or multi-client environments where exceptions are the norm, not the exception.

Then comes the Redwood mobile experience, which in my opinion is one of the most impactful shifts. Warehouse operations live and die on usability. If the UI slows users down, adoption drops. Redwood is clearly designed with the operator in mind cleaner navigation, faster interactions, and a more intuitive flow. This is not just a UI upgrade; it directly impacts productivity on the floor.

On the integration side, the introduction of OAuth-based authentication is a major step forward. Many of us have seen the pain points around managing integrations securely across WMS, ERP, and external systems. OAuth simplifies this while strengthening security posture something that becomes critical as ecosystems grow more connected.

What really signals the future, though, is the continued push toward AI-driven capabilities. We are moving beyond transactional systems into intelligent platforms. Whether it’s predictive insights, smarter task prioritization, or data-driven decision support, AI is no longer optional, it’s becoming embedded into the core of supply chain execution.

And finally, the logistics improvements reinforce the need for tighter synchronization between warehouse and transportation. In reality, warehouse efficiency means little if it is not aligned with outbound planning and delivery execution. These enhancements help bridge that gap.
From a consulting standpoint, this release raises an important point:

Technology is no longer the constraint. Adoption and execution are.

The organizations that will benefit the most from 26B are not the ones that simply upgrade, but the ones that actively rethink their processes, retrain their users, and realign their integration strategies.
Because ultimately, features don’t drive transformation, decisions do.

Why Oracle Cloud WMS and ERP Inventory Go Out of Sync - and How to Fix It

Oracle Cloud WMS and Oracle ERP are designed to work together, but inventory mismatches still happen in many real implementations due to wrong planning. The most common reasons are UOM differences, transaction timing gaps, integration failures, manual adjustments, and process variation across warehouse operations.

The core problem
In Oracle environments, WMS often operates with real-time warehouse execution, while ERP inventory may rely on different update timing or integration logic, which can create temporary or persistent mismatches. Oracle customer discussions also show a concrete example: ERP can work with primary or secondary UOM at the sales order level, while WMS typically assumes primary UOM, which causes shipping and inventory discrepancies. Oracle documentation also confirms that integration errors are visible in WMS Cloud interfaces and that failed records must be corrected and reprocessed, which shows how fragile inventory sync can become when master data or dependent data is missing.

Why it happens
The most common causes are:
  • Unit-of-measure mismatches between ERP and WMS.
  • Different transaction timing, where one system posts faster than the other.
  • Integration failures or validation errors in inbound and outbound messages.
  • Manual stock corrections that do not flow cleanly across systems.
  • Data structure differences and poor master data quality.
These issues become more visible in high-volume businesses because even a small delay or mismatch can multiply across thousands of transactions per day.

What it looks like in industries

FMCG
FMCG companies move fast, with short shelf life, frequent replenishment, and high SKU turnover. If WMS and ERP are not synchronized, the result can be overstocks, stockouts, and inaccurate replenishment decisions, especially when promotional demand spikes suddenly. In that environment, even a small UOM or timing mismatch can distort available stock and disrupt dispatch planning.

Retail
Retail is highly sensitive to inventory accuracy because store replenishment, e-commerce fulfillment, and returns all depend on trusted stock balances. Oracle’s retail WMS documentation highlights how integration errors must be identified, corrected, and reprocessed, which shows how operationally disruptive a bad interface can be when merchandise flow is continuous. In retail, the real business risk is not just an inventory mismatch, it is lost sales and broken customer promise.

Healthcare
Healthcare has a different pressure point: stock accuracy directly affects patient care. Oracle has highlighted new healthcare inventory capabilities that automate stock tracking, update balances, and trigger replenishment because manual processes can cause delays, shortages, and poor visibility. In hospitals and labs, inventory sync failures can mean missing critical supplies at the wrong time, which is much more serious than a standard warehouse discrepancy.

How to fix it
A practical fix is not one single setting, it is a control framework:
  • Standardize UOM rules across ERP and WMS before go-live.
  • Use automated integration and near-real-time sync instead of manual batch reconciliation.
  • Monitor interface errors in WMS and reprocess failed records quickly.
  • Lock down master data governance for items, UOM, locations, and ownership rules.
  • Define a clear exception process for manual adjustments so every correction is traceable.
Run frequent cycle counts and reconciliation audits to catch drift early.
Oracle’s own integration guidance for WMS Cloud shows that validation failures are surfaced in interface screens and corrected records can be reprocessed, which makes operational monitoring essential rather than optional. Oracle also provides integration recipes to sync inventory, purchase orders, receipts, and shipments between ERP/SCM Cloud and WMS Cloud, reinforcing that structured integration is the right direction.

A simple example
Imagine a retailer receiving 100 cartons of an item. If ERP records the order in carton units but WMS processes the shipment in pieces, inventory may appear correct in one system and wrong in the other until the transaction is converted consistently. In healthcare, the same kind of mismatch could prevent replenishment of critical consumables, which is why Oracle has pushed automation and RFID based replenishment to improve visibility and reduce manual entry errors.

Oracle Cloud WMS and ERP inventory go out of sync when organizations expect software to fix a process problem that actually needs master data control, integration discipline, and exception management. The companies that solve it best are the ones that treat inventory accuracy as a cross-functional operating model, not just an IT project.
